Finance Review Summary — Board Circulation

Warranty costs on the Ardent heater line exceeded plan by 28% this quarter, driven by elevated failure rates in units shipped from the Belmora facility. A corrective rework programme is underway and the reserve has been increased accordingly. Cash impact is manageable within existing facilities. No covenant issues arise. The forward plan is summarised below.

board note of yadup-fajef: Druiusox Holdings is in early talks to buy Norwynek Systems for about $186.0 million. The Kaseth launch date is June 24, and nothing goes to the press before then. Legal wants the Quenethek Group term sheet withdrawn before November 27.

Ticket: drift on Sweepwell retention sweeper. Plugin authors — the sweeper config in prod no longer matches what's in the repo; someone hand-edited retention windows last month and plugins relying on the documented 90-day floor are deleting early. Do not ship against the repo values until this closes. Reconciliation is scheduled for next Tuesday. For reference, the current live sweeper configuration is pasted below.

settings of tagef-bawif:
DRUIX_HOST=druix.zemvarlabs.internal
DRUIX_PORT=8000

For the incoming director: the review covers the last four quarters across the Wrenfield and Caldo product families. Margins slipped from 41% to 36%, driven chiefly by input-cost inflation on the Caldo sensor line and discounting in the Bremholt channel. I have documented the supplier renegotiation underway and flagged two SKUs for possible discontinuation. All working papers are in the shared finance folder. Please read the full pack before the January pricing committee. The confidential business context follows directly below.

board note of bahaf-kahif: Gross margin on Wenael came in at 10 percent against a plan of 15 percent. Only 7 of the 120 pilot accounts renewed Wenael, so a churn review is set for July 1.